Teen Mom Jenelle Evans In Court: No Deal From District Attorney

Troubled Teen Mom star Jenelle Evans made her first appearance in a North Carolina court Tuesday morning for the charges stemming from the video taped fight she allegedly got into with another girl in March.

Jenelle's attorney Dustin Sullivan exclusively told RadarOnline.com that the Brunswick County district attorney did not offer his client a plea deal and they are "going into this as if we're going to trial."

Article continues below advertisement

The 19-year-old MTV reality star has had multiple run-ins with the law since late 2010 but Sullivan said she is back on track  now.  "She's doing really well.  Mentally she's in a lot better spot than she was a few weeks ago."

The  incident with Brittany Truett and Brittany Maggard was allegedly a fight over Jenelle's on-and-off-again boyfriend Kieffer Delp, but Sullivan told RadarOnline.com "she's not supposed to be hanging out with Kieffer."

This case was continued to May 24, but Jenelle will be back in court Friday, April 29 for breaking and entering charges from a  separate case  in 2010.
